Re: [PATCH] Lower tarball compression level



Cody A.W. Somerville wrote:
>  I'd like to propose the attached patch which changes "--best" to
> "--fast" in the lh_binary_tar helper. Using "--best" (the highest level
> of compression) can take 20% longer to complete but only provides 4-5%
> better compression. This performance impact can quickly be inflated when
> performing on platforms such as ARM. To put this in perspective, I did a
> few unscientific tests.

as mentioned before, your point is totally valid, however, in the
default case i'd like to stick with best as there's imho not much point
in building release builds with --fast.

therefore, in git, i've added a --gzip-options switch to change the gzip
options.
